Psychology
A mental health professional who uses psychological evaluations and talk therapy to help people learn to better cope with life and relationship issues and mental health conditions.

Physiotherapy
Physiotherapists use manual therapy techniques, such as massage and exercise, to help people manage pain and prevent disease. They also provide education and advice for patients of all ages.

Chiropractic
Chiropractors focus on diagnosing and treating the misalignment of joints which can cause other disorders that affect the nerves, muscles, and organs. They use non-surgical treatments, such as spinal manipulation and mobilisation, to treat patients with back or leg pain (sciatica), neck pain, repetitive strain injuries and even headaches.

Podiatry
Podiatry deals with the prevention, diagnosis, treatment, and rehabilitation of medical and surgical conditions of the feet and lower limbs. Podiatrists treat and manage conditions resulting from disorders like arthritis, circulatory disease, neurological diseases, and muscular pathologies.

Dietetics
Dietitians specialise in food, diet management, and nutrition for people who may be affected by health conditions such as diabetes, obesity, cancer, heart disease, renal disease, gastrointestinal diseases, and food allergies. They can significantly reduce the risk of developing chronic disease through education about a balanced diet.
